Subject: [PRCo] The Donora Picture


My reaction to the Donora Picture is how long the motorman could keep  
a clean face in that environment if he kept the front window open?     
The youngsters today have no clue just how filthy those steel towns  
were.

The loss of industry has really cleaned up the air.   The loss of  
steam locomotives cleaned up the air.   But I'm also amazed at just  
how much pollution control equipment on cars has made the air  
cleaner.   I can remember summer evenings 40 years ago in Lancaster  
had poorly defined shadows after seven o'clock.   Now the air is  
clear and the shadows are crisp.   I think we've honestly made some  
improvements to our life.
